Who Is Adam Levine?
Adam Levine is an American singer, songwriter, multi-instrumentalist and actor. He is the lead vocalist for the Los Angeles pop rock band Maroon 5. Levine was born in Los Angeles, California, to a Jewish family. As a teenager he performed with his brothers in a rock band called Kara’s Flowers.

Adam Levine Arm Tattoos
In 2010, Adam added a tattoo in his right arm of a heart with “Mom” written inside. This is dedicated to his mom Patsy.

Adam Levine has a flower tattoo on his left shoulder.

Adam Levine’s “X” tattoo, the Roman numeral representing the number 10, celebrating Maroon 5’s 10 year anniversary as a band. Behind his left forearm is a detailed guitar tattoo.

Adam also had a tiger tattoo crawling on his right arm.

Adam Levine Chest Tattoos
Adam Levine has a flying eagle tattoo on his chest.

Adam Levine Body Tattoos
On his left chest there is a tattoo written in either Hindi or Sanskrit.
A shark on his rib cage is rumored to have something to do with a nickname but sharks are one of Adam Levine’s biggest fears.

Adam Levine Back Tattoos
This was Adam’s latest tattoo on his back, he got this epic mermaid holding a skull tattoo from his favorite tattoo artist, Bryan Randolph, of Spider Murphy’s Tattoo in San Rafael, California.
